One of such cases is when a managed class is being initialized during JITting and the constructor is in an assembly that's not found. The bug results in skipping all the native frames upto a managed frame that called that native chain that lead to the exception. In the specific case I've mentioned, a lock in the native code is left in locked state. That later leads to a hang. This was case was observed with Roslyn invoking an analyzer where one of the dependencies was missing. The fix is to ensure that when ThePreStub is called by CallDescrWorkerInternal, the exception is not caught in the PreStubWorker. It is left flowing into the native calling code instead.
